Tatisilwai Station, station code TIS, is the railway station serving the capital city of Ranchi in the Ranchi district in the Indian state of Jharkhand. Tatisilwai Station belongs to the Ranchi division of the South Eastern Railway Zone of the Indian Railway.

Ranchi has trains running frequently to Delhi and Kolkata. The city is a major railway hub and has four major stations: Ranchi Junction Hatia Station, Tatisilwai Station and Namkom Station. Many important trains start from Ranchi Junction as well.

Facilities

The major facilities available are Waiting rooms, Reservation Counter, Vehicle parking etc. The vehicles are allowed to enter the station premises. There are tea stall, book stall, post and telegraphic office. Security personnel from the Government Railway police(G.R.P) and Railway Protection Force (RPF) are present for security.

Platforms

There are three platforms which are interconnected with foot over bridge (FOB).

Nearest airports

The nearest airports to Tatisilwai Station are:[3]

  1. Birsa Munda Airport, Ranchi 14 kilometres (8.7 mi)
  2. Gaya Airport, Gaya 180 kilometres (110 mi)
  3. Lok Nayak Jayaprakash Airport, Patna 279 kilometres (173 mi)
  4.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ose International Airport, Kolkata 355 kilometres (221 mi)
